Two Hump Rock at Pulau Wajang in Waigeo Island offers an exceptional Raja Ampat diving experience. This spectacular site features twin rocky pinnacles rising dramatically from the seafloor, creating a distinctive underwater landscape for divers of all levels.

Divers typically explore depths ranging from 5 to 40 meters, with intermediate to advanced skills recommended due to strong currents common in the Halmahera Sea. The rock formations provide excellent opportunities for drift diving and underwater photography.

Marine life encounters include schooling jacks, trevally, snappers, and groupers patrolling the pinnacles. Reef sharks, rays, and Napoleon wrasse are frequently spotted. The healthy coral-covered slopes support vibrant reef systems with abundant smaller species like nudibranches, crustaceans, and colorful reef fish.

Two Hump Rock’s unique topography creates excellent current channels that concentrate marine life, making this a premier destination within the Raja Ampat archipelago. The site’s combination of dramatic geology, strong biodiversity, and reliable wildlife sightings makes it a must-dive location for experienced underwater explorers visiting West Papua.
